For a 2013 Chevy 2500, the recommended cold cranking amps (CCA) typically range from 650 to 800 CCA, depending on the engine type and configuration. It's best to consult the owner's manual or check with a dealership to ensure you select a battery that meets the specific requirements for your model. Choosing a battery with higher CCA can provide better performance in colder climates.

The cranking amps required for a Mercedes-Benz S430 typically ranges between 600 to 800 CCA (Cold Cranking Amps), depending on the model year and engine specifications. It's essential to consult the owner's manual or a professional to determine the exact requirements for your specific vehicle. Ensuring the battery meets or exceeds this specification is crucial for reliable starting, especially in colder climates.
